For a parallel plate transmission line, let v be the speed of propagation and Z be the characteristic impedance. Neglecting fringe effects, a reduction of the spacing between the plates by a factor of two results in

(A) halving of v and no change in Z

(B) no change in v and halving of Z

(C) no change in both v and Z

(D) halving of both v and Z

Correct option (B) no change in v and halving of Z

Explanation:

Z0 = (276/√∈r)log(d/r)

d  → distance between the two plates

so, zo – changes, if the spacing between the plates changes. 

V = 1/√LC → independent of spacing between the plates
